The Swift Package Index logo.Swift Package Index

Build Information

Successful build of metal-tools with Swift 5.7 for macOS (SPM).

Build Command

env DEVELOPER_DIR=/Applications/Xcode-14.2.0.app xcrun swift build --arch arm64

Build Log

========================================
RunAll
========================================
Builder version: 4.33.2
Interrupt handler set up.
========================================
Checkout
========================================
Clone URL: https://github.com/eugenebokhan/metal-tools.git
Reference: 1.1.1
Initialized empty Git repository in /Users/admin/builds/Z6YBxSjp/0/finestructure/swiftpackageindex-builder/spi-builder-workspace/.git/
From https://github.com/eugenebokhan/metal-tools
 * tag               1.1.1      -> FETCH_HEAD
HEAD is now at d49d18c fix integral image
Cloned https://github.com/eugenebokhan/metal-tools.git
Revision (git rev-parse @):
d49d18ccea9c556eb1a8af595fb9d85b9d0d918c
SUCCESS checkout https://github.com/eugenebokhan/metal-tools.git at 1.1.1
========================================
Build
========================================
Selected platform:         macosSpm
Swift version:             5.7
Building package at path:  $workDir
https://github.com/eugenebokhan/metal-tools.git
Running build ...
env DEVELOPER_DIR=/Applications/Xcode-14.2.0.app xcrun swift build --arch arm64
Building for debugging...
[0/35] Copying TextRender.metal
[0/35] Copying PointsRenderer.metal
[0/35] Copying RectangleRender.metal
[3/35] Copying SimpleGeometryRender.metal
[3/35] Copying MaskRenderer.metal
[3/35] Copying LinesRenderer.metal
[6/35] Copying Common.metal
[7/35] Copying HelveticaNeue.mtlfontatlas
[8/35] Copying TextureWeightedMix.metal
[8/35] Copying YCbCrToRGBA.metal
[8/35] Copying TextureMultiplyAdd.metal
[8/35] Copying TextureMix.metal
[9/35] Copying TextureMin.metal
[13/35] Copying TextureMean.metal
[13/35] Copying TextureMax.metal
[15/35] Copying TextureMaskedMix.metal
[15/35] Copying TextureResize.metal
[15/35] Copying Shared
[15/35] Copying TextureMask.metal
[15/35] Copying TextureDifferenceHighlight.metal
[18/35] Copying TextureCopy.metal
[21/35] Copying TextureAffineCrop.metal
[21/35] Copying TextureDivideByConstant.metal
[22/35] Copying TextureInterpolation.metal
[22/35] Copying TextureAddConstant.metal
[22/35] Copying RGBAToYCbCr.metal
[23/35] Copying QuantizeDistanceField.metal
[26/35] Copying MaskGuidedBlur.metal
[26/35] Copying StdMeanNormalization.metal
[29/35] Copying LookUpTable.metal
[29/35] Copying EuclideanDistance.metal
[29/35] Copying BitonicSort.metal
[32/35] Compiling MetalRenderingToolsSharedTypes MetalRenderingToolsSharedTypes.c
[33/35] Compiling MetalComputeToolsSharedTypes MetalComputeToolsSharedTypes.c
[35/110] Compiling MetalComputeToolsTestsResources resource_bundle_accessor.swift
[36/110] Compiling MetalComputeToolsTestsResources Bundle+TestsResources.swift
[37/110] Emitting module MetalComputeToolsTestsResources
[38/110] Compiling MetalTools MTLComputeCommandEncoder+Dispatch.swift
[39/110] Compiling MetalTools MTLComputePipelineState+Threads.swift
[40/110] Compiling MetalTools MTLContext+CommandQueue.swift
[41/110] Compiling MetalTools MTLDevice+Convenience.swift
[42/110] Compiling MetalTools MTLDevice+Features.swift
[43/110] Compiling MetalTools MTLDevice+IsDiscrete.swift
[44/110] Compiling MetalTools MTLDevice+MTLTexture.swift
[45/117] Compiling MetalTools MTLTextureCodableContainer.swift
[46/117] Compiling MetalTools MTLTextureDescriptorCodableContainer.swift
[47/117] Compiling MetalTools CVPixelBuffer+MTLTexture.swift
[48/117] Compiling MetalTools CVPixelFormat+Extensions.swift
[49/117] Compiling MetalTools Decoder+MTLDevice.swift
[50/117] Compiling MetalTools MTLBlitCommandEncoder+Copy.swift
[51/117] Compiling MetalTools MTLBuffer+Contents.swift
[52/117] Emitting module SwiftMath
[53/117] Compiling MetalTools MTLCPUCacheMode+Codable.swift
[54/117] Compiling MetalTools MTLClearColor+Clear.swift
[55/117] Compiling MetalTools MTLCommandBuffer+Dispatching.swift
[56/117] Compiling MetalTools MTLCommandBuffer+ExecutionTime.swift
[57/117] Compiling MetalTools MTLCommandQueue+Schedule.swift
[58/117] Compiling MetalTools MTLCompileOptions+Extensions.swift
[59/117] Compiling MetalTools MTLComputeCommandEncoder+Arguments.swift
[60/117] Compiling SwiftMath easing.swift
[61/117] Compiling SwiftMath float3x3+Extensions.swift
[62/117] Compiling SwiftMath float4x4+Extensions.swift
[63/117] Compiling SwiftMath functions.swift
[64/117] Compiling SwiftMath platform.swift
[65/117] Compiling SwiftMath random.swift
[66/117] Compiling SwiftMath utils.swift
[66/117] Archiving libSwiftMath.a
[68/117] Emitting module MetalTools
[69/133] Compiling MetalTools MTLRegion+Area.swift
[70/133] Compiling MetalTools MTLRegion+Clamp.swift
[71/133] Compiling MetalTools MTLRegion+Codable.swift
[72/133] Compiling MetalTools MTLRegion+Equitable.swift
[73/133] Compiling MetalTools MTLRenderCommandEncoder+SetValue.swift
[74/133] Compiling MetalTools MTLRenderPassAttachmentDescriptor+Extensions.swift
[75/133] Compiling MetalTools MTLRenderPipelineColorAttachmentDescriptor+BlendingMode.swift
[76/133] Compiling MetalTools MTLResource+AccessibleOnCPU.swift
[77/133] Compiling MetalTools MTLResourceOptions+Extensions.swift
[78/133] Compiling MetalTools MTLSize+Clamp.swift
[79/133] Compiling MetalTools MTLSize+Codable.swift
[80/133] Compiling MetalTools MTLSize+Convenience.swift
[81/133] Compiling MetalTools MTLSwize+Equitable.swift
[82/133] Compiling MetalTools MTLSizeAndAlign+Extensions.swift
[83/133] Compiling MetalTools MTLStorageMode+Extensions.swift
[84/133] Compiling MetalTools MTLTexture+Array.swift
[96/133] Compiling MetalTools MTLPixelFormat+CGBitmapInfo.swift
[97/133] Compiling MetalTools MTLPixelFormat+CVPixelFormat.swift
[98/133] Compiling MetalTools MTLPixelFormat+Codable.swift
[99/133] Compiling MetalTools MTLPixelFormat+ColorSpace.swift
[100/133] Compiling MetalTools MTLPixelFormat+Extensions.swift
[118/133] Compiling MetalTools MTLTexture+Codable.swift
[119/133] Compiling MetalTools MTLTexture+Extensions.swift
[120/133] Compiling MetalTools MTLTexture+Image.swift
[121/133] Compiling MetalTools MTLTextureDescriptor+Copy.swift
[122/133] Compiling MetalTools MTLTextureDescriptor+Encodable.swift
[123/133] Compiling MetalTools MTLTextureType+Codable.swift
[124/133] Compiling MetalTools MTLTextureUsage+Codable.swift
[125/133] Compiling MetalTools MTLVertexAttributeDescriptor+Extensions.swift
[126/133] Compiling MetalTools MTLVertexAttributeDescriptorArray+Extensions.swift
[127/133] Compiling MetalTools MPSNNGraph+Functors.swift
[128/133] Compiling MetalTools MPSUnaryImageKernel+Functors.swift
[129/133] Compiling MetalTools MTLContext+Capture.swift
[130/133] Compiling MetalTools MTLContext+Device.swift
[131/133] Compiling MetalTools MTLContext.swift
[132/133] Compiling MetalTools Metal.swift
[133/133] Compiling MetalTools MetalError.swift
[134/158] Emitting module MetalComputeTools
[135/166] Compiling MetalComputeTools TextureDifferenceHighlight.swift
[136/166] Compiling MetalComputeTools TextureDivideByConstant.swift
[137/166] Compiling MetalComputeTools TextureInterpolation.swift
[138/166] Compiling MetalComputeTools TextureMask.swift
[139/166] Compiling MetalComputeTools TextureMaskedMix.swift
[140/166] Compiling MetalComputeTools TextureMax.swift
[141/166] Compiling MetalComputeTools TextureMean.swift
[142/166] Compiling MetalComputeTools TextureMin.swift
[143/166] Compiling MetalComputeTools MPSUnaryImageKernels.swift
[144/166] Compiling MetalComputeTools MaskGuidedBlur.swift
[145/166] Compiling MetalComputeTools QuantizeDistanceField.swift
[146/166] Compiling MetalComputeTools RGBAToYCbCr.swift
[147/166] Compiling MetalComputeTools StdMeanNormalization.swift
[148/166] Compiling MetalComputeTools TextureAddConstant.swift
[149/166] Compiling MetalComputeTools TextureAffineCrop.swift
[150/166] Compiling MetalComputeTools TextureCopy.swift
[151/166] Compiling MetalComputeTools Matrix3x3f+Extensions.swift
[152/166] Compiling MetalComputeTools BitonicSort.swift
[153/166] Compiling MetalComputeTools BitonicSortFinalPass.swift
[154/166] Compiling MetalComputeTools BitonicSortFirstPass.swift
[155/166] Compiling MetalComputeTools BitonicSortGeneralPass.swift
[156/166] Compiling MetalComputeTools EuclideanDistance.swift
[157/166] Compiling MetalComputeTools IntegralImage.swift
[158/166] Compiling MetalComputeTools LookUpTable.swift
[159/166] Compiling MetalComputeTools TextureMix.swift
[160/166] Compiling MetalComputeTools TextureMultiplyAdd.swift
[161/166] Compiling MetalComputeTools TextureNormalization.swift
[162/166] Compiling MetalComputeTools TextureResize.swift
[163/166] Compiling MetalComputeTools TextureWeightedMix.swift
[164/166] Compiling MetalComputeTools YCbCrToRGBA.swift
[165/166] Compiling MetalComputeTools MetalTools.swift
[166/166] Compiling MetalComputeTools resource_bundle_accessor.swift
[167/182] Emitting module MetalRenderingTools
[168/186] Compiling MetalRenderingTools UIFont+Rect.swift
[169/186] Compiling MetalRenderingTools MTLFontAtlas.swift
[170/186] Compiling MetalRenderingTools MTLFontAtlasCodableContainer.swift
[171/186] Compiling MetalRenderingTools MTLFontAtlasDescriptor.swift
[172/186] Compiling MetalRenderingTools MetalTools.swift
[173/186] Compiling MetalRenderingTools GlyphDescriptor.swift
[174/186] Compiling MetalRenderingTools MTLFontAtlasProvider.swift
[175/186] Compiling MetalRenderingTools MTLIndexBuffer.swift
[176/186] Compiling MetalRenderingTools TextMesh.swift
[177/186] Compiling MetalRenderingTools MTLRenderCommandEncoder+Draw.swift
[178/186] Compiling MetalRenderingTools BoundingBoxesRenderer.swift.swift
[179/186] Compiling MetalRenderingTools LabelRender.swift
[180/186] Compiling MetalRenderingTools LinesRenderer.swift
[181/186] Compiling MetalRenderingTools MaskRenderer.swift
[182/186] Compiling MetalRenderingTools PointsRenderer.swift
[183/186] Compiling MetalRenderingTools RectangleRender.swift
[184/186] Compiling MetalRenderingTools SimpleGeometryRender.swift
[185/186] Compiling MetalRenderingTools TextRender.swift
[186/186] Compiling MetalRenderingTools resource_bundle_accessor.swift
Build complete! (25.65s)
Fetching https://github.com/SwiftGFX/SwiftMath.git from cache
Fetched https://github.com/SwiftGFX/SwiftMath.git (0.20s)
Computing version for https://github.com/SwiftGFX/SwiftMath.git
Computed https://github.com/SwiftGFX/SwiftMath.git at 3.3.1 (0.04s)
Creating working copy for https://github.com/SwiftGFX/SwiftMath.git
Working copy of https://github.com/SwiftGFX/SwiftMath.git resolved at 3.3.1
warning: 'spi-builder-workspace': found 1 file(s) which are unhandled; explicitly declare them as resources or exclude from the target
    /Users/admin/builds/Z6YBxSjp/0/finestructure/swiftpackageindex-builder/spi-builder-workspace/Sources/MetalComputeTools/Kernels/IntegralImage/IntegralImage.metal
Build complete.
Done.